Las Vegas needs assets for the future, and trading Meyers could be a key part in getting that.
After a tough start to the 2025 NFL season, the Las Vegas Raiders need to embrace the future. There was plenty of talk about a playoff push thanks to veteran acquisitions, the hiring of Super Bowl-winning coach Pete Carroll and adding experienced offensive coordinator Chip Kelly.
Things have not panned out that way, and the Raiders are staring down the barrel of another year without a postseason appearance.
